Olivier,
I just walked the OID .1.3.6.1.4.1.43.2.13.8.4.0 and it gives me CPU
Utilization of 6 on our NetBuilder-II DP 80. It could be that the MIB
file I have is for this particular processor board. You might want to
dig through the 3com knowledge base and see if they give a different OID
for your processor board.
